A centrifugal pump is only as reliable as the mechanical seal protecting its stuffing box. In chemical plants, water treatment facilities, refineries, and food processing lines, more unplanned pump downtime traces back to seal failure than to bearings, impellers, or motor faults combined. For maintenance managers and procurement teams, the single most impactful decision is moving from component seals to cartridge mechanical seals — and then selecting the correct cartridge configuration for the exact duty.

Why Cartridge Seals Outperform Component Seals

A component mechanical seal arrives as loose parts: rotary face, stationary seat, springs, drive collar, elastomers. The installer must measure spring compression, set the working length, and assemble everything inside the stuffing box. One miscalculation — a spring compressed 1/16" too far or a face set 0.5 mm too deep — and the cartridge mechanical seal fails within days.

A cartridge mechanical seal ships fully pre-assembled on a sleeve with a gland plate and setting clips that lock the factory-set compression. Installation is straightforward: slide the cartridge onto the shaft, bolt the gland to the stuffing box, tighten the drive collar set screws, and remove the setting clips. There is no spring-length math, no loose parts to drop into the pump, and no field assembly error.

Lifespan Comparison: For centrifugal pumps in continuous chemical or water service, cartridge mechanical seals routinely deliver 18–36 months of operation versus 3–9 months for field-assembled component seals. The labor savings alone — a 30-minute cartridge swap versus a 2-hour component rebuild — justify the modest price premium.

Step 1: Identify the Pump and Shaft Details

Every cartridge mechanical seal specification starts with the pump. You need three measurements:

  • Shaft diameter — the most critical dimension. Standard series cover 14 mm, 16 mm, 18 mm, 20 mm, 22 mm, 25 mm, 28 mm, 30 mm, 32 mm, 35 mm, 40 mm, 45 mm, 50 mm, 55 mm, 60 mm, 65 mm, 70 mm, 75 mm, 80 mm, 90 mm, and 100 mm. A 35 mm shaft is among the most common in chemical centrifugal pumps.

  • Stuffing box bore (D3/D7) — the inside diameter of the cartridge mechanical seal chamber where the gland plate seats.

  • Seal chamber depth (L3) — from the stuffing-box face to the impeller rear shroud.

These three dimensions define the envelope. Most standard pumps (ANSI B73.1, ISO 5199/DIN 24960) follow predictable envelopes, so a John Crane 58U cartridge at 35 mm, a Burgmann M7N cartridge at 35 mm, and a Miaoyu MY-58U or MY-M7N at 35 mm share the same dimensional footprint. This interchangeability is what allows maintenance teams to standardize on one supplier without re-machining the pump.

Quick Reference for Common Pump Brands and Shaft Diameters:
  • Grundfos CR/CRI vertical multistage: 12 mm, 16 mm, 22 mm, 28 mm, 32 mm

  • KSB Etanorm / CPKN: 35 mm, 45 mm, 55 mm, 70 mm

  • Sulzer APP / AHLSTAR: 40 mm, 50 mm, 65 mm, 80 mm

  • Goulds 3196 (ANSI): 1.375", 1.750", 2.125", 2.500" (35 mm, 44.5 mm, 54 mm, 63.5 mm)

Step 2: Define the Fluid — Chemistry Dictates Everything

The pumped fluid determines face materials, elastomer type, and whether you need a single or double seal.

  • Water and mild aqueous fluids (pH 6–8, ≤80 °C): Carbon vs Silicon Carbide faces, NBR or EPDM O-rings. A standard O-ring pusher cartridge like the John Crane 58U, Burgmann MG1/M7N, or Miaoyu MY-58U is the economical choice.

  • Hot water and boiler feed (120–180 °C): Carbon vs SiC or TC vs SiC faces, EPDM or FKM. Consider a stationary bellows or a balanced cartridge to control face heat.

  • Acids and aggressive chemicals: Silicon Carbide vs Silicon Carbide faces for maximum corrosion resistance. FKM for most acids below 150 °C; PTFE wedge or welded metal bellows for halogenated acids, concentrated sulfuric above 120 °C, or hot caustic.

  • Hydrocarbons and oils: Tungsten Carbide vs Silicon Carbide or Carbon vs TC. FKM elastomers. For hot oil above 200 °C, a metal bellows cartridge (John Crane 606, Burgmann H7N, Miaoyu MY-606) is mandatory — no O-ring can survive.

  • Slurries and abrasive fluids: Tungsten Carbide vs Silicon Carbide. The hard-face pair resists abrasive wear. A single cartridge with flush plan (API Plan 32 or 53A) keeps solids away from the lapped faces.

Step 3: Temperature and Pressure Limits

ParameterStandard O-Ring CartridgeMetal Bellows Cartridge
Max continuous temperature~200 °C (FKM), ~250 °C (FFKM)400–425 °C
Min temperature-40 °C (FKM), -50 °C (EPDM)-100 °C (bellows + grafoil)
Max pressure (balanced)16–25 bar16–25 bar
Max shaft speed≤25 m/s≤25 m/s
Important Notice: For any service above 200 °C — hot oil, asphalt, amine, steam — the elastomer in an O-ring cartridge will degrade. A welded metal bellows cartridge removes the dynamic elastomer entirely, using an all-metal bellows (316SS, Inconel 625, or Hastelloy C-276) as spring, torque transmitter, and secondary seal.

Step 4: Single, Double, or Tandem Arrangement?

  • Single cartridge seal (Arrangement 1): One seal set. Suitable for clean, non-toxic, non-flammable fluids at moderate pressure. Examples: John Crane 58U, Burgmann M7N, AESSEAL M03S, Miaoyu MY-58U.

  • Double cartridge seal (Arrangement 3): Two seals face-to-face with a barrier fluid between. Required for toxic, flammable, abrasive, or vacuum service. The barrier fluid (typically clean water, oil, or compatible solvent) is pressurized 1–2 bar above the pump pressure. Examples: John Crane 5020, Burgmann Cartex-SN, Miaoyu MY-DOUBLE series.

  • Tandem seal (Arrangement 2): Two seals in series for high-pressure or high-temperature duty where a double seal will not fit. Less common in standard centrifugal pumps.

For most water treatment, HVAC, and mild chemical transfer, a single cartridge is correct. For chlorine, phosgene, hot concentrated acids, or flammable solvents, specify a double cartridge.

Step 6: Face Material Selection Guide

Fluid ConditionRotary FaceStationary FaceElastomer
Clean water, ≤80 °CCarbon (Resin Impregnated)SiCNBR
Hot water, ≤180 °CCarbon (Antimony Filled)SiCEPDM
Mild chemicals, ≤150 °CSiCSiCFKM
Acids, ≤120 °CSiCSiCFKM
Hot acids, >150 °CSiCSiCPTFE / Grafoil
Hydrocarbons, ≤200 °CTCSiCFKM
Hot oil, >200 °CSiCSiCMetal Bellows
Slurries / abrasivesTCSiCFKM or PTFE

Bottom Line

Selecting the right cartridge mechanical seal for a centrifugal pump is a matter of matching five variables — shaft size, fluid chemistry, temperature, pressure, and safety requirement — to a proven seal platform. For water and mild chemicals below 150 °C, an O-ring pusher cartridge (John Crane 58U / Burgmann M7N / AESSEAL M03S class) is the cost-effective standard. For hot oil, aggressive acids above 150 °C, or halogenated service, step up to a welded metal bellows cartridge (John Crane 606 / Burgmann H7N class). For toxic or flammable fluids, a double cartridge is non-negotiable.
